Skip to content

Commit ab7ce1c

Browse files
Remove --host and --target arguments to configure
These arguments are passed to the relevant x.py invocation in all cases anyway. As such, there is no need to separately configure them. x.py will ignore the configuration when they are passed on the command line anyway.
1 parent 29f5c69 commit ab7ce1c

File tree

36 files changed

+27
-52
lines changed

36 files changed

+27
-52
lines changed

src/ci/docker/arm-android/Dockerfile

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-31,9 +31,7 @@ ENV PATH=$PATH:/android/sdk/platform-tools
3131

3232
ENV TARGETS=arm-linux-androideabi
3333

34-
ENV RUST_CONFIGURE_ARGS \
35-
--target=$TARGETS \
36-
--arm-linux-androideabi-ndk=/android/ndk/arm-14
34+
ENV RUST_CONFIGURE_ARGS --arm-linux-androideabi-ndk=/android/ndk/arm-14
3735

3836
ENV SCRIPT python2.7 ../x.py test --target $TARGETS
3937

src/ci/docker/armhf-gnu/Dockerfile

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-76,9 +76,7 @@ RUN curl -O http://ftp.nl.debian.org/debian/dists/jessie/main/installer-armhf/cu
7676
COPY scripts/sccache.sh /scripts/
7777
RUN sh /scripts/sccache.sh
7878

79-
ENV RUST_CONFIGURE_ARGS \
80-
--target=arm-unknown-linux-gnueabihf \
81-
--qemu-armhf-rootfs=/tmp/rootfs
79+
ENV RUST_CONFIGURE_ARGS --qemu-armhf-rootfs=/tmp/rootfs
8280
ENV SCRIPT python2.7 ../x.py test --target arm-unknown-linux-gnueabihf
8381

8482
ENV NO_CHANGE_USER=1

src/ci/docker/asmjs/Dockerfile

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-29,6 +29,6 @@ ENV EM_CONFIG=/emsdk-portable/.emscripten
2929

3030
ENV TARGETS=asmjs-unknown-emscripten
3131

32-
ENV RUST_CONFIGURE_ARGS --target=$TARGETS --enable-emscripten
32+
ENV RUST_CONFIGURE_ARGS --enable-emscripten
3333

3434
ENV SCRIPT python2.7 ../x.py test --target $TARGETS

src/ci/docker/disabled/aarch64-gnu/Dockerfile

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-74,7 +74,6 @@ COPY scripts/sccache.sh /scripts/
7474
RUN sh /scripts/sccache.sh
7575

7676
ENV RUST_CONFIGURE_ARGS \
77-
--target=aarch64-unknown-linux-gnu \
7877
--qemu-aarch64-rootfs=/tmp/rootfs
7978
ENV SCRIPT python2.7 ../x.py test --target aarch64-unknown-linux-gnu
8079
ENV NO_CHANGE_USER=1

src/ci/docker/disabled/dist-aarch64-android/Dockerfile

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,8 +14,6 @@ ENV DEP_Z_ROOT=/android/ndk/arm64-21/sysroot/usr/
1414
ENV HOSTS=aarch64-linux-android
1515

1616
ENV RUST_CONFIGURE_ARGS \
17-
--host=$HOSTS \
18-
--target=$HOSTS \
1917
--aarch64-linux-android-ndk=/android/ndk/arm64-21 \
2018
--disable-rpath \
2119
--enable-extended \

src/ci/docker/disabled/dist-armv7-android/Dockerfile

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-20,8 +20,6 @@ ENV DEP_Z_ROOT=/android/ndk/arm-14/sysroot/usr/
2020
ENV HOSTS=armv7-linux-androideabi
2121

2222
ENV RUST_CONFIGURE_ARGS \
23-
--host=$HOSTS \
24-
--target=$HOSTS \
2523
--armv7-linux-androideabi-ndk=/android/ndk/arm \
2624
--disable-rpath \
2725
--enable-extended \

src/ci/docker/disabled/dist-i686-android/Dockerfile

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-20,8 +20,6 @@ ENV DEP_Z_ROOT=/android/ndk/x86-14/sysroot/usr/
2020
ENV HOSTS=i686-linux-android
2121

2222
ENV RUST_CONFIGURE_ARGS \
23-
--host=$HOSTS \
24-
--target=$HOSTS \
2523
--i686-linux-android-ndk=/android/ndk/x86 \
2624
--disable-rpath \
2725
--enable-extended \

src/ci/docker/disabled/dist-x86_64-android/Dockerfile

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,8 +14,6 @@ ENV DEP_Z_ROOT=/android/ndk/x86_64-21/sysroot/usr/
1414
ENV HOSTS=x86_64-linux-android
1515

1616
ENV RUST_CONFIGURE_ARGS \
17-
--host=$HOSTS \
18-
--target=$HOSTS \
1917
--x86_64-linux-android-ndk=/android/ndk/x86_64-21 \
2018
--disable-rpath \
2119
--enable-extended \

src/ci/docker/disabled/dist-x86_64-dragonfly/Dockerfile

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-32,5 +32,5 @@ ENV \
3232

3333
ENV HOSTS=x86_64-unknown-dragonfly
3434

35-
ENV RUST_CONFIGURE_ARGS --host=$HOSTS --enable-extended
35+
ENV RUST_CONFIGURE_ARGS --enable-extended
3636
ENV SCRIPT python2.7 ../x.py dist --host $HOSTS --target $HOSTS

src/ci/docker/disabled/dist-x86_64-haiku/Dockerfile

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-42,8 +42,8 @@ RUN sh /scripts/sccache.sh
4242
ENV HOST=x86_64-unknown-haiku
4343
ENV TARGET=target.$HOST
4444

45-
ENV RUST_CONFIGURE_ARGS --host=$HOST --target=$HOST --disable-jemalloc \
45+
ENV RUST_CONFIGURE_ARGS --disable-jemalloc \
4646
--set=$TARGET.cc=x86_64-unknown-haiku-gcc \
4747
--set=$TARGET.cxx=x86_64-unknown-haiku-g++ \
4848
--set=$TARGET.llvm-config=/bin/llvm-config-haiku
49-
ENV SCRIPT python2.7 ../x.py dist
49+
ENV SCRIPT python2.7 ../x.py dist --host=$HOST --target=$HOST

0 commit comments

Comments
 (0)